WebAs part of the revalidation process, your regional deanery or LETB (Local Education & Training Board) will collect a Form R (Part B) from you at certain times during your training programme. For all doctors in the East of England who are in training programmes, HEE EoE will request the Form R (Part B) from you approximately 6-8 weeks prior to ...
